The Earth will be fine

Posted by Rhiannon Fionn-Bowman on Wed, Apr 22, 2009 at 11:00 AM

According to Joseph Romm, of ClimateProgress.org, you can stop worrying about the planet, it'll be fine. We're the ones who are screwed.

Dumping Earth Day has been on my mind for a year now -- and all the more so today because the NYT magazine just published an interview with our Nobel-prize winning Energy Secretary, Steven Chu, in which he says:

I would say that from here on in, every day has to be Earth Day.

Well, duh! Heck, we have a whole day just for the trees -- and we haven’t finished them offyet. So if every day is Earth Day, than April 22 definitely needs a new name.

I don’t worry about the earth. I’m pretty certain the earth will survive the worst we can do to it. I’m very certain the earth doesn’t worry about us. I’m not alone. People got more riled up when scientists removed Pluto from the list of planets than they do when scientists warn that our greenhouse gas emissions are poised to turn the earth into a barely habitable planet.
